Transaction

6a14c86d6dced96c04c7e7f52dd01191e4e1ece6117dec951f5e99f1b19316aa
587,816 confirmations
Timestamp
1429474922
Block352,812
Fee10,000 sats
Fee rate15 sats/vB
view on mempool.space

Inputs & Outputs